Just What Brings Kassie DePaiva and One Life to Live’s Blair Cramer to General Hospital Revealed
When daytime fan favorite, Kassie DePaiva, drops into Port Charles and General Hospital, she will be reprising her One Life to Live role as Blair Cramer.
Circle this Friday, September 15th for the start of Kassie’s stint.
According to TV Line, in story, it will be revealed that Blair is the ‘mysterious’ third wife of Martin Grey (Michael E. Knight). Look for DePaiva to share scenes not only with Knight, but the one and only Jane Elliot (Tracy Quartermaine).

Photo: JPI
This is not Blair’s first trip to Port Charles. DePaiva brought her Llanview alter-ego to GH back in March of 2012, just two months after One Life to Live went off the air on ABC.

Photo: JPI
At that time, Blair was part of a story arc on GH that lasted several months, along with Roger Howarth, who was then playing Todd Manning. Howarth is still on the show today in his third incarnation as Austin Gatlin-Holt.

Photo: JPI
Fans may remember the “What If'” ABC Daytime short-form stories and promos. One of which featured Knight as AMC’s Tad Martin meeting DePaiva’s Blair Cramer on an airplane flight. You can check that out below.

‘General Hospital’ Alum Kelly Monaco Reveals She’s Six Months Sober

Longtime General Hospital favorite, Kelly Monaco (ex-Sam McCall), took to her Instagram on Tuesday, September 15 and shared that she is six months, seven days sober from alcohol. Monaco played Sam for 21 years on the ABC soap opera.
Accompanied by a screenshot from the I Am Sober app that tracks the progress of anyone struggling with or trying to not drink, Monaco wrote, “Now the whole 6/7 thing makes sense! #duces.”
Monaco has kept a very low profile since her final episode on General Hospital aired back on October 30, 2024, when Sam had a shocking heart attack and died. It was later revealed that Daytime Emmy nominee, Jeff Kober (ex-Cyrus Renault) injected Sam’s IV with a fatal dose of digitalis.

Photo: JPI
KELLY MONACO HAS KEPT MORE TO HERSELF SINCE LEAVING GH
This year, Kelly has posted on her Instagram account a total of four times, most recently to celebrate her mother, Carmina’s birthday, who turned 70 just four days ago.
Jumping into the comment thread on Kelly announcing her sobriety were several of her former GH co-stars including Brandon Barash (ex-Johnny, GH) who shared, “Love this. Congrats! 👏👏👏,” Ingo Rademacher (ex-Jax, GH) who just posted the hands up and heart emojis, and Lexi Ainsworth (ex-Kristina, GH) who wrote, “So proud of you 👏 badass.”

Photo: ABC
DANCING WITH THE STARS BEGINS NEW SEASON; KELLY WAS THE SEASON ONE CHAMP
With this season’s Dancing with the Stars about to kick-off tonight, in which Kelly was the first-ever celebrity winner in season one and returned for an All-Star version, might we hear from her on her picks or thoughts on this year’s batch of contestants?
One thing has remained a constant with Kelly’s unwavering fan base, they want her back on General Hospital, because as we know in the soaps, many characters somehow come back from the dead, so why couldn’t Sam?

Soap Alums Remembered During In Memoriam Segment at 78th Emmy Awards; Patrick Muldoon Omitted

During last night’s 78th annual Primetime Emmy Awards ceremony, as it does every year, the television academy paid tribute to those in the industry that they’ve lost over the last year; since the previous Emmys held each year in September.
Starting with an emotional tribute to the late Catherine O’Hara by three of her co-stars, Schitt’s Creek’s Annie Murphy and Dan Levy and Home Alone’s Macaulay Culkin, the segment then dovetailed into Noah Kahan performing “Bridge over Troubled Water” as the faces and the names of those being remembered were shown on the screen.
Daytime soap alums, who either stayed in the genre for the majority of their career, or went on to primetime success as well, were honored including: Anthony Geary (Luke, GH), Hayden Panettiere (Sarah, OLTL, Lizzie, GL, Juliette, Nashville), James Van Der Beek, (Dawson, Dawson’s Creek, and Stephen, ATWT), Gil Gerard (Alan, The Doctors), June Lockhart (Mariah, GH), Patricia Crowley (Mary, Port Charles and GH), Randolph Mantooth (Clay/Alex, Loving and The City, and Richard, GH) and Jon Cypher (Alex, ATWT and Arthur, Santa Barbara).

Photo: TVAcademy
THOSE HONORED AND THOSE WHO WERE NOT
However, in a glaring omission, the producers of the In Memoriam failed to include Days of our Lives beloved star, Patrick Muldoon who played the OG Austin Reed and also Richard Hart on Melrose Place. Muldoon passed away in April of this year at 57.
After Kahan concluded his performance, a special tribute to Rob Reiner began with Jamie Lee Curtis taking to the stage to share some warm words about her late friend.
In a ironic and sad twist, Curtis shared ,“Last week, Robbie won an Emmy for guest actor in a comedy series for his beautiful work on The Bear, and he now holds the record of 48 years for the longest gap between acting Emmys, which was previously held by his father Carl Reiner, at 37 years.”
Reiner, who along with his wife, Michele Reiner were killed by their son, Nick Reiner, is currently awaiting a decision if he will stand trial. Prosecutors on Tuesday, shared they will not seek the death penalty if he is convicted at trial, but instead life in prison. Curtis said of Rob, “He was generous and kind and funny as hell, and a friend to all. We all miss Rob and Michele and all those we lost this year.” The Emmys then faded to black and went to commercial break.

GENERAL HOSPITAL: Jason and Britt Break Up After Realizing They Can’t Trust Each Other

Trust issues were cited as the reason for the break-up of Jason Morgan (Steve Burton) and Dr. Britt Westbourne (Kelly Thiebaud) on the Monday, September 14 episode of General Hospital, ending the their complicated romance once and for all.
The episode began with the pick-up of Jason and Britt’s argument over Anna Devane (Finola Hughes) at the Quartermaine boathouse. Britt is in disbelief that Jason continues to take Anna’s side, and that he will not back her up as her witness, as she wants to report Anna’s attempted murder of her to the PCPD.
Jason tells Britt that Anna had been pushed to the brink through the mental torture she’d endured while held captive at Wyndemere, and accused Britt of doing nothing to save her, when she knew exactly what was going on as she was at Wyndemere as well. Britt told Jason that she’d been a victim of Sidwell and Cullum too, and by the time she figured out what was happening to Anna, they had moved her somewhere else.

Courtesy/ABC
BELIEF SYSTEM BROKEN
Then, Jason clearly lets Britt know he doesn’t believe her version of what transpired. An enraged Britt fires back at Jason in disbelief, that he is siding with Anna instead of her, when he was on Mount Emerson and saw for himself how Anna was planning to kill her. Suddenly, Britt wants to know if Jason would have helped Anna cover her tracks, if Anna had killed her.
Next, Jason argued that Britt seemingly needs to believe Anna would have killed her when he knows deep down Anna would never have murdered her. Jason thinks Britt is trying to absolve herself of her own guilt and complicity in keeping Anna locked up.
Britt shouts “You need to believe that! Otherwise, you’d have to admit that your friend is unhinged and dangerous. And she would have killed someone you say you love!” Now at a complete impasse, Britt walks out on Jason realizing they don’t trust each other and calls it quits.

Courtesy/ABC
PICKING UP THE PIECES
Later, Jason finds Carly (Laura Wright) at the Metro Court, and while in an elevator fills her in that he doesn’t trust Britt, and that as much as he loves her, he doesn’t trust her like he does Carly. Britt is back at the hospital.
A concerned Tristan (Dean Geyer) tries to talk to her about what transpired with Anna. However, Britt clams up and walks away from any discussion.
